
Leave it up to the internet to take a totally innocent photo of the Pope and turn it into a rap meme that’s getting more popular by the second. In the photo you see above, Pope Francis was at a camp for internally displaced people in Bangui, Central African Republic, on Sunday as part of his three-nation tour in Africa. While there, he was photographed giving his blessing.
However, a number of people on social media decided that the Pope looked like he was doing more than just giving his blessing. Instead Pope Francis was dropping lyrics to his myriad of rap songs about life, love, and everything else.
Granted it does look like Francis is about to drop a few beats into the mic, but come on people. He was at an event which was talking about poverty and helping out the less fortunate? Still though, you have to admit it’s kind of funny. Next thing you know this picture’s going to be photoshopped with Francis sporting some serious bling.
